Red light camera teaches driver a lesson
The Gazette Opinion Staff
Apr. 17, 2010 12:38 am
I received a notice in the mail stating that the automatic red light enforcement program violation had been served. After reading and seeing my offense, I was speechless.
No way is there any justification for what I did.
I paid the fine; this is penalty enough. I am living of a fixed income and because of this situation I have to make due with what money is left.
My lesson has been learned. Pay attention, practice patience and follow the rules so there is no reason to get caught.
Glenda Sharp
Cedar Rapids
